A Brief History of Air Jordan

If you haven’t been living under a rock for the past 35 years, then you have probably heard about one of the most iconic sneakers on the market, the Air Jordan. Named for basketball superstar, Michael Jordan, these shoes have become a household name since they first debuted in the mid-1980s.

It Started with the Jordan 1

Long before Michael Jordan came along, the NBA started a committed relationship with Converse. That’s right, NBA players were rocking Chuck Taylors on the courts until the mid-1980s. Michael Jordan, however, was a superstar, and he knew that partnering with Converse just wasn’t going to let him carve out his niche in shoe history.

Jordan then turned to Nike to create the iconic Air Jordan 1; a red, black, and white high-top sneaker. Nike expected the shoes to be popular, but they couldn’t have predicted that they were going to exceed their initial sales goal by $123 million in the first year of sales.

They Were Initially Banned

Naturally, when you have your own sneakers, you’re going to want to wear them on the court at all of your games. Michael Jordan did just that, and it made huge waves with the NBA.

At the time, the NBA had a rule that sneakers worn during games had to be mostly white and contain the colors of the team’s jersey. The first Air Jordans were mostly red and black, so the NBA banned them. It has been reported that the NBA fined Michael Jordan $5,000 every time he wore his famous kicks during a game. Naturally, Nike loved the publicity they garnered and willingly paid out all the fines that Jordan accrued.

From Banned to Status Symbol

The Air Jordan has not waned in popularity since their introduction, even though Michael Jordan has long since retired from professional play. During the 80s and 90s, every cool kid had several pairs of Air Jordans in their closet.
